What Edgemoor's Climate Does to a Deck

Salt Air Off Bellingham Bay

Edgemoor's bluff-top and shoreline-adjacent lots sit close enough to Bellingham Bay that salt-laden air is a regular presence, more so than it would be a few miles inland in the same city. A deck has no wall or roofline to shield it from that air, and salt accelerates corrosion in exposed metal — fasteners, brackets, post hardware, railing connectors — well before any of it looks obviously bad. On a structure people stand and walk on, corroding hardware is a strength problem before it's a cosmetic one.

Wind-Driven Rain on Exposed and Elevated Lots

Storms coming off the water don't fall straight down on Edgemoor's bluff — wind pushes rain sideways and drives it up under railings, into ledger connections, and between deck boards that aren't gapped correctly. Elevated decks built to take advantage of the bay view catch more of that wind-driven rain than a sheltered, tree-covered deck would, which changes what the railing, fastening, and drainage details need to do on a view-oriented build versus one tucked back under the canopy.

Heavy Tree Cover and a Long Moss Season

The flip side of Edgemoor's wooded lots is shade, needle and leaf litter, and a moss season that runs longer here than it would on an open, sun-exposed site. Mild year-round temperatures and near-constant moisture already give moss a long growing season across this part of Whatcom County, and a shaded deck under fir and cedar cover gets it worse — needles and debris hold water against the surface, and any decking material with even a little surface porosity gives moss something to grip.

Bluff-Top vs. Wooded Lot: Two Different Decks

Edgemoor isn't one uniform building site, and that matters more here than it does in a lot of neighborhoods. A deck built for a bluff-top lot with open bay exposure needs to handle stronger, more direct wind-driven rain and higher UV exposure with less natural shade to slow moss growth. A deck built back under tree cover on a wooded lot gets less wind and sun, but more standing shade, more organic debris landing on the surface, and a longer window where the decking stays damp between storms. Neither situation is harder than the other across the board — they're just different failure modes, and a deck designed around the wrong one tends to underperform even if the material itself is a good choice.

Choosing the Right Decking Material for This Setting

Material choice matters more on an Edgemoor lot than it would on a drier, more open site, because the gap between a well-suited product and a poorly suited one shows up faster under these conditions. The three main categories homeowners weigh are pressure-treated or cedar wood, capped composite, and cellular PVC.

Wood

Pressure-treated lumber and cedar look good when new and fit the wooded character of an Edgemoor lot naturally, but both need regular sealing or staining to hold up against sustained shade and moisture, and both are more vulnerable to fastener corrosion in salt-tinged air over time. Left unmaintained even a season or two under heavy tree cover, wood here is usually the first material to show moss, graying, and soft spots.

Capped Composite

Capped composite boards have a plastic shell around a wood-fiber composite core, which resists moisture absorption, staining, and moss far better than uncapped composite or wood. Under Edgemoor's tree cover and bay-adjacent air, that cap layer is doing real work — it's the difference between a board that needs occasional washing and one that needs ongoing sealing to keep moss and staining off shaded sections.

Cellular PVC

PVC decking contains no wood fiber at all, so it doesn't absorb moisture the way even capped composite can at cut edges or fastener holes. It costs more than composite and can flex more under heavy point loads, but for a heavily shaded, moisture-exposed deck tucked under trees, or an elevated deck taking the full brunt of bay wind, some homeowners find the added moisture resistance worth it.

MaterialHandling Salt Air & MoistureMoss Resistance Under Tree CoverUpkeep
Cellular PVCExcellent — no wood fiber to absorb moistureStrong, smooth non-porous surfaceOccasional washing
Capped compositeStrong — cap layer resists moisture and stainingGood on most linesOccasional washing
Uncapped compositeModerate — some moisture absorption at exposed fiberFair; prone to buildup in shaded areasPeriodic cleaning
CedarModerate — natural resistance, but needs sealingFair when sealed and kept clear of debrisRegular oiling or sealing
Pressure-treated woodWeak against sustained salt exposure over timePoor without regular treatmentRegular sealing or staining

What a Correctly Built Deck Involves Here

The visible decking surface gets most of the attention when homeowners picture a new deck, but in Edgemoor's conditions, the framing, fasteners, and drainage details underneath are what actually determine how long it lasts. A build done right for this neighborhood includes:

  • Framing material suited to sustained shade and moisture exposure — pressure-treated lumber rated for the application, sized correctly for the span and load
  • Stainless steel or coastal-grade corrosion-resistant fasteners throughout, not standard hardware that starts corroding in salt-tinged air within a few seasons
  • Hidden fastener systems on the deck surface where the product allows, reducing exposed metal and giving a cleaner walking surface
  • Correct board gapping for drainage and material movement, so wind-driven rain, needle litter, and standing moisture can actually drain and dry between boards
  • Proper ledger board flashing where the deck ties into the house, since that connection point is one of the most common places moisture gets in on a poorly built deck
  • Joist spacing matched to the specific decking product's span rating rather than a generic framing layout
  • Railing and post attachment sized for the wind exposure the site actually sees, especially on elevated, view-oriented decks near the bluff edge
  • Footings and substructure engineered for the actual slope, on the sloped and terraced lots common throughout Edgemoor
  • Ventilation and grading underneath the deck so moisture and debris don't sit against the framing between storms

Skip any one of those and the deck usually still looks fine on day one. The problems show up a few winters later, as a soft joist, a loosening railing post, or fastener corrosion staining the boards around it.

Design Considerations Specific to Edgemoor Properties

Beyond material and structure, an Edgemoor deck has site-specific design questions worth working through before anything gets built. Bluff-top and view-oriented lots raise the question of how open a railing design can be without giving up too much wind protection, versus how much a partial glass panel or screen adds without blocking the view it's built to take advantage of. Heavily wooded lots raise the opposite set of questions — how much sun a deck actually gets through the canopy, which decking colors and materials hold up best against moss in deep shade, and whether overhead branches need attention before or after the build to cut down on debris landing on the new surface.

Grade and elevation change quickly on many Edgemoor lots, which affects drainage design, stair placement, and how much substructure work a sloped site needs before decking ever goes down. A deck stepping down a hillside toward the water usually needs more engineering attention at the footings and support posts than a single-level deck off the back of a flat-lot home, even before the decking material enters the conversation. None of these are one-size-fits-all answers, which is part of why a deck designed for a specific Edgemoor lot performs differently than a stock layout dropped onto any site in the neighborhood.

What Your Deck Still Needs From You

Even a well-built deck in the right material needs some routine attention in this setting to get its full lifespan. A short list worth keeping in mind:

  • Sweep needles, leaves, and other debris off the surface and out of the board gaps regularly, especially on shaded decks under heavy tree cover
  • Rinse the deck periodically to clear salt residue and organic buildup before it works into the surface or cap layer
  • Check railing posts and hardware once a year for early corrosion or loosening, especially heading into the wet season
  • Trim back overhanging branches that hold moisture against the deck, drop excess debris, or block what sun and airflow the site does get
  • Address any soft framing or standing water underneath right away — that's a structural issue, not a cosmetic one, and it doesn't improve with time

What exactly does a "capped" composite deck board mean, and does it matter here?

Capped composite has a plastic shell wrapped around a wood-fiber composite core, so moisture, staining, and moss have a much harder time getting into the board compared to uncapped composite. In a shaded, bay-adjacent setting like Edgemoor, that cap layer is doing real work rather than just being a marketing feature, which is why we lean on capped products for most composite installs here.
